アレルギー,寄生虫,そして衛生仮説
Maria Yazdanbakhsh1, Peter G Kremsner, Ronald van Ree
1Department of Parasitology, Leiden University Medical Center, Leiden, Netherlands. M.Yazdanbakhsh@LUMC.NL
まとめ
ヘルミント感染症のような持続的な感染症は,抗炎症反応を誘発することにより,アレルギーを予防することができます. これは,少数の小児感染症がアレルギーの罹患率を増加させるという考えに異議を唱える.

背景:
- アレルギー性疾患は工業国において増加しており,しばしば小児期の感染症の減少に関連しています.
- 衛生仮説は,微生物への曝露が減少すると,Tヘルパー1 (TH1) とTヘルパー2 (TH2) 細胞の反応が不均衡になり,アレルギーが好ましいと示唆しています.

主要な成果:
- 感染症の減少がアレルギーを増加させるという考えは,TH1型自己免疫疾患の増加と,TH2型歪みヘルミント感染症とのアレルギー関連性の欠如によって挑戦されています.
- 長期のヘルミント感染症は,インタールウィキン-10のような抗炎症性サイトカインの上昇と関連しています.
- これらのサイトカインは,アレルギーの有病率と逆相関を示しています.
結論:
- ヘルミント感染症などの持続的な免疫課題は,強力な抗炎症的規制ネットワークを誘発します.
- このネットワークは,多くの感染症とアレルギー疾患の間に観察された逆の関連性に対する統一的な説明を提供します.
- この発見は,感染,免疫調節,アレルギーの発症の間の相互作用が,これまで理解されていたよりも複雑であることを示唆している.

Infection
When a pathogen enters the body and reproduces, it can cause an infection, damage body cells, and cause illness symptoms that eventually lead to disease. Therefore, its prevention requires breaking the chain of infection.

Standard Precaution
Standard precautions are the minimum infection control safeguards used while caring for all patients, irrespective of their disease condition. They help prevent the spread of common infectious microorganisms to healthcare workers, patients, and visitors in all healthcare settings.

Amebiasis
Entamoeba histolytica, a protozoan parasite, is responsible for intestinal and extraintestinal amebiasis. Though a significant proportion of infections remain asymptomatic, approximately 50 million individuals annually are estimated to present with clinical disease, resulting in up to 100,000 deaths globally.
